Foreign policy in Germany will become feminist

On March 1, the Minister of Foreign Affairs, Annalena Baerbock, and the Minister of Economic Cooperation and Development, Svenja Schulze, presented an 88-page plan for the country's feminist foreign policy that the German government has published. 

According to the plan, at least 8% of German development funds must go to projects related to gender equality. Another 85% of funds should consider this objective as secondary. In total, within the program's framework, it is planned to invest 12 billion euros in this way. A position of "feminist foreign policy ambassador" will also be established.
